Runbook: waveform preview in Soundline. If previews render blank, the peaks cache in the transcode worker is stale; flush it and re-enqueue the asset. Reviewers should confirm the decoder pin matches the lockfile before approving. When filing the fix, include the build token printed below for the affected worker image.

trace token, fafog-kageg: htk4_98e6

Drift detected on the TailScope CLI between the audit host and the build farm. The deployed binary reads overrides from a stale profile, so retention and redaction flags differ from what the policy repo declares. No evidence of tampering, but please verify independently. For reference, the intended baseline configuration is below.

config for kahag-tawif:
WENIEL_PIN=9090
WENIEL_TENANT=druwyn
WENIEL_METRICS_HOST=metrics.weniel.brasksys.internal
WENIEL_SEAL=seal_a0690e94
WENIEL_STANDBY_TEAM=druir

## Drift: Deep-link routing mismatch

Plugin authors: the Wayfare deep-link router in staging has drifted from the published spec. Custom scheme handlers registered before last Tuesday may resolve to stale routes. Re-register against the current manifest. Until the drift is reconciled, validate against the staging values shown below.

deployment values, yadug-bawif:
[framir]
team = pelox
access_code = ac_a38ab2
owner = tamion.julael
host = framir.tolvaqlabs.test
port = 11211
peer = tammir.zemvargrid.local
salt = 2215ef03
pin = 1541

Welcome to the Harrowell platform review. You are assessing our ongoing refactor of the legacy Stonewick ORM layer, which historically interpolated identifiers into raw SQL. The replacement, Quartzline, uses parameterized queries throughout, and each migrated module is tagged in the audit manifest. Please verify that deprecated adapters are flagged read-only and that no dual-path writes remain. To inspect the sealed audit account, initiate the recovery flow in Pellgrove and enter the recovery passphrase given below.

unlock words, yawig-kagef: gordor-holvan-ulaael-pramir-ulaiel-tamdor